What a Spiritually Awakened Person Sees in Others
A spiritually awakened person often develops a heightened awareness and sensitivity to the emotions, energies, and behaviors of others. This heightened awareness transcends the physical realm and delves into the subtle energies and behavioral patterns that shape human interactions. Here are some key observations that guide their perceptions:
Energy Levels
These individuals may sense the energy or aura of others, recognizing when someone is vibrant, drained, or carrying negative energy. This ability to perceive energetic imbalances can provide valuable insights into the emotional states and physical well-being of those around them.
Emotional States
They can often intuitively understand the emotions of others, picking up on subtle cues that indicate joy, sadness, anxiety, or anger. This emotional empathy serves as a powerful tool for building deeper connections and fostering a supportive environment.
Authenticity
There’s a heightened sensitivity to how genuine or authentic people are in their interactions. They can quickly recognize when someone is being true to themselves versus when they are putting on a facade. This awareness fosters trust and honesty in relationships.
Fear and Insecurity
Spiritually awakened people often become more aware of the fears and insecurities that drive people's behaviors. This understanding leads to greater compassion and understanding, fostering a supportive and nurturing environment.
They observe recurring patterns in others' behaviors, such as reactions to stress, communication styles, or relational dynamics. Recognizing these patterns can help them provide strategic advice and support for personal growth and improvement.
Judgment and Criticism
These individuals notice how frequently people judge or criticize themselves and others. This tendency often stems from personal insecurities, and recognizing it can help them offer valuable guidance and support.
There's a heightened awareness of the human desire for connection and belonging. They recognize how this influence interactions and relationships, fostering a deeper sense of community and empathy.
Resistance to Change
They may see how some individuals resist personal growth or change, often out of fear or comfort in familiarity. Understanding this resistance can help them facilitate positive change in a gentle and supportive manner.
Spiritual Disconnect
These individuals may notice when others are disconnected from their spiritual essence or purpose, leading to feelings of emptiness or dissatisfaction. Recognizing this gap can prompt a discussion about personal spirituality and self-fulfillment.
Compassion and Kindness
They may recognize acts of compassion and kindness more readily, appreciating the impact these have on both the giver and the receiver. This focus on positivity can inspire others to engage in similar acts, fostering a more compassionate community.
These observations can lead to deeper empathy and a desire to connect with others on a more meaningful level, fostering healthier relationships and a greater sense of community. By understanding and supporting these aspects, spiritually awakened individuals contribute positively to their communities and enhance their own well-being.
